制定化疗和生物管理标准:组织临床护士专家带领实践变革

护士们接受了循环炼技术的培训,以标准化小量输液的管理. 这种基于证据的实践确保了药物完整的输送,并提高了瘤学环境中的患者护理质量.
科学领域:
- 瘤学 护理 护理专业
- 基于证据的实践.
- 输液治疗是一种输液疗法.
背景情况:
- 鉴于缺乏机构标准,鉴于化学疗法和生物药物管理实践的差异.
- 标准化小量输液的管理对于患者的安全性和治疗疗效至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 描述标准化小体积输液施用方法的成功实施,采用循环启动技术.
- 详细说明国家癌症研究所指定癌症中心护士的教育和培训过程.
主要方法:
- 临床护士专家 (CNSs) 与一个跨专业团队合作,领导了一项全系统的实践变革.
- 进行了为期2周的软推出,随后进行了为期20分钟的教育模块,为护理人员提供了实践培训.
- 培训培训师模式和每日汇报被用来支持护士和解决故障问题.
主要成果:
- 91%的前线护士 (在714名护士中,有643名) 接受了循环启动技术的教育.
- 培训包括安全,冲洗,编程,处理和患者教育.
- 标准化方法在内部传播,并开发了患者教育材料.
结论:
- 临床护士专家在建立最佳实践和实施基于证据的建议方面发挥着关键作用.
- 循环启动技术确保了完整的药物输送,优化了患者的护理.
- 标准化的护理实践对于高质量的化疗和生物疗法管理至关重要.
